What is a magnetic windshield cover?
In contrast to simple foils or tarpaulins, which often slip or are blown away by the wind, the magnetic version has integrated magnets on the edge. These adhere securely to the bodywork of your car and ensure that the cover stays in place even in wind and weather. Attaching the cover is child's play: simply place it on the windshield and the magnets will automatically hold it in place.
Advantages in winter and summer
In winter, the cover protects against frost, ice and snow. No more scraping ice in the morning - simply pull off the cover and drive off. In summer, it reflects the sun's rays and prevents the car from heating up too much. This keeps the steering wheel pleasantly cool and protects the dashboard from UV rays.
Practical and versatile
Many models can be used universally and fit different vehicle types. They can be folded up compactly and stowed in the trunk. Cleaning is uncomplicated: A damp cloth is usually enough to remove dirt.
What should you look out for?
When buying, make sure the cover is well made and has strong magnets so that it will hold even in stormy weather. However, some vehicles with an aluminum body do not offer a hold for magnets - other fastening options are required here.
